Quote of the day by Dwight Eisenhower: 'Every gun that is made, every warship launched, every rocket fired signifies…'

In his 1953 address, former U.S. President Dwight D. Eisenhower articulated a critical perspective on military spending, asserting that every weapon produced and every military vessel commissioned represents a diversion of essential resources away from social services. Eisenhower's remarks highlighted the moral and economic repercussions of prioritizing militarization over human welfare, urging nations to strike a balance between maintaining security and investing in societal needs. His message resonates in today's context, as countries grapple with the dual challenges of ensuring national defense while addressing pressing social issues such as healthcare, education, and poverty alleviation. Eisenhower's call for a more equitable allocation of resources remains relevant as global tensions persist and the debate surrounding military budgets continues to intensify. This reflection on his timeless wisdom serves as a reminder of the importance of human welfare in the face of security concerns.
